Understanding Downtime and Its Impact on Blue Collar Workforce
Downtime, whether planned or unplanned, leads to a direct loss of productivity. For blue-collar workforce who rely on machinery, tools, or specific workflows, any disruption can result in significant delays. The impact isn’t just felt in lost hours but also in missed deadlines, reduced product quality, and potential customer dissatisfaction.
By implementing a robust performance management system, companies can minimize these disruptions. Through continuous evaluation, PMS helps identify problem areas that lead to downtime, allowing leaders to create actionable strategies to mitigate them.
Monitoring and Analyzing Performance for Downtime Reduction
One of the primary features of a performance management system is real-time monitoring of employee performance. For blue-collar workforce, this means tracking operational efficiency, identifying bottlenecks, and spotting patterns that contribute to downtime.
By collecting data on how employees interact with their equipment, how long certain tasks take, and what issues frequently arise, companies can analyze trends and target the root causes of downtime. This insight helps managers make informed decisions to improve operational flow and reduce unnecessary pauses in work.
Proactive Maintenance and Skill Enhancement
Performance management doesn’t just involve monitoring; it also requires proactive intervention. With performance data in hand, managers can see when machines or processes are likely to fail or slow down. By scheduling maintenance based on performance metrics rather than waiting for breakdowns, companies can prevent unexpected downtime.
Additionally, performance management systems can identify gaps in employee skills. Ensuring that employees are trained to operate machines effectively or troubleshoot issues before they become major problems reduces the time lost due to mechanical or human errors.
Real-Time Feedback and Immediate Adjustments
A significant advantage of using performance management systems for blue-collar workforces is the ability to give real-time feedback. Employees can receive instant reports on their performance, which helps them adjust their pace or methods as needed.
This immediate feedback mechanism not only enhances productivity but also helps employees become more self-sufficient. As they receive continuous performance insights, they can learn to resolve minor issues independently, reducing the need for frequent managerial intervention and minimizing downtime.
Clear Role Definition and Task Allocation
One of the key causes of downtime in a blue-collar workforce is unclear task allocation or role confusion. Without a clear understanding of who is responsible for what, delays occur when employees are unsure of their next steps or overlap in duties arises.
Performance management systems ensure that roles are clearly defined, and tasks are efficiently allocated. By setting clear expectations and tracking task completion, these systems reduce the likelihood of bottlenecks, ensuring smoother workflow and greater operational efficiency.

Reducing Downtime with Workforce Flexibility
In industries reliant on blue-collar employees, downtime can occur when key employees are unavailable due to illness, vacation, or other unforeseen reasons. A performance management system helps identify multi-skilled employees who can fill in when required, ensuring that operations continue without disruption.
By tracking individual skill sets and performance, managers can create a more flexible workforce that can adapt to changing circumstances, reducing the impact of absenteeism or staff shortages.
Enhanced Communication and Collaboration
Miscommunication is a common cause of downtime in blue-collar settings. When employees don’t have the right information at the right time, delays occur as they wait for clarification or instructions. Performance management systems often include tools that enhance communication and collaboration across teams.
These tools ensure that all team members are on the same page, with real-time updates on task progress and expectations. Enhanced communication reduces misunderstandings and eliminates delays caused by poor information flow, significantly improving efficiency.
